#e28e9f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e28e9f is composed of 88.6% red, 55.7% green and 62.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 37.2% magenta, 29.6%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 347.9 degrees, a saturation of 59.2% and a lightness of 72.2%. #e28e9f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#c51d3f.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

Shades and Tints of #e28e9f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0305 is the darkest color, while #fefbf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#e28e9f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bcb4b6 is the less saturated color, while #fd738f is the most saturated one.
